Projekte suchen
Anzeige-Eigenschaften
Projekte 25 bis 32 von 74
|
Erstellt von
Luckie, 20. Sep 2007
OOP Dialog-Template based on Windows API dialog resources
Ich habe mir mal eine nonVCL-Dialog Vorlage erstellt, also quasi so etwas, wie ein Grundgerüst. Ich habe das jetzt mal objekt orientiert programmier nach dem ich so ein Grundgerüst lange Zeit nur prozedural hatte:
type
TMpuDialog = class(TObject)
private
FHandle: THandle;
FhAccelTbl: THandle;
FDlgFuncPtr: Pointer;
FMsg: UINT;
FwParam: WPARAM;
FlParam: LPARAM;
|
Erstellt von
Luckie, 10. Aug 2007
Memory Spiel
Einfaches Memory Spiel
Entstanden ist das Memory Spiel aus diesem Thread heraus: http://www.delphipraxis.net/internal_redirect.php?t=116000
Letzt endlich ist es nichts tolles, es soll eben nur vermitteln, demonstrieren, wie man so etwas OOP konform lösen kann.
Der Code der Memory-Klassen hat sich zu der Version aus dem Thread noch etwas geändert, so dass der Spielfeldverwalter jetzt wirklich nur für das Spielfeld verantwortlich ist und der Spielleiter (hier die Form) nur das Spiel leitet.
|
Erstellt von
Luckie, 6. Jan 2007
MpuAboutWnd
Ihr habt eventuell mitbekommen, dass ich heute kräftig an einem About-Dialog gearbeitet habe. Und mit der Hilfe von NicoDE und xarmox ist es mir dann auch gelungen das ganze zu meiner vollsten Zufriedenheit fertig zu stellen.
Ich wollte schon immer einen About-Dialog haben, der hübsch anzusehen und im Quellcode leicht zu handhaben ist. Früher habe ich MessageBoxen benutzt. Aber selbst meine benuterspezifischen MessageBoxen waren mir dann irgendwann mal etwas zu langweilig. Also habe ich mich heute mal hingesetzt und habe mir die Arbeit gemacht und einen About-Dialog...
|
Erstellt von
Luckie, 19. Mär 2007
Kleiner Uninstaller
Man liefert ja öfters Programm ohne Setup aus, weil es sich einfach nicht lohnt bzw. das Setup in keinem Verhältnis zum ausgelieferten Programm steht. Aber trotzdem werden von dem Programm Einträge in die Registry geschrieben, die der Benutzer gerne wieder entfernen möchte. Nun kann man aber nicht jedem Benutzer zu muten diese Einträge in der Registry zu suchen und selber löschen zu lassen. Deswegen habe ich mir eben mal schnell einen eigene Uninstaller geschrieben, der die Einträge wieder aus der Registry entfernt.
Es handelt sich um ein Konsolenprogramm unter...
|
Erstellt von
Luckie, 19. Dez 2006
Customized About MessageBox
Man kennt das ja vielleicht. Man hat ein kleines Tool geschrieben und jetzt will man noch einen About-Dialog anzeigen. Um das Programm nicht noch mit einem zusätzlichen Formular aufzublähen oder um nicht noch einen zusätzlichen Dialog in einer WinAPI-Anwendung erstellen zu müssen, benutzt man eine einfache MessageBox. Jetzt hätte man es aber gerne, dass der Benutzer doch irgendwie die Möglichkeit hat, die Homepage zu besuchen. Entweder man macht nun doch einen zusätzlichen Dialog / Form oder man bohrt die MessageBox etwas auf. Und genau das habe ich gemacht. Rausgekommen...
|
Erstellt von
Luckie, 18. Okt 2003
DiskImage
DiskImage erstellt und schreibt Disketten-Images (nur NT ff.)
Features:
- Laufwerksauswahl
- Fortschrittsanzeige beim Lesen der Diskette.
- Fortschrittsanzeige bei der Low-level Formatierung der Diskette.
- Fortschrittsanzeige beim Schreiben des Images.
- Scheiben ud Lesen erfolgt in Threads.
- Exe ist nur 54 KB groß.
- Sourcen sind im Archiv drin, inklusive der nötigen Header-Übersetzungen der Jedis.
|
Erstellt von
Luckie, 16. Jan 2003
Toolbox
Sammlung mit Include-Dateien mit nützlichen Routinen für die Programmierung ohne VCL.
Download:
Toolbox.7z
Toolbox.zip
|
Erstellt von
Luckie, 16. Jan 2004
Adressdatenbank
So, ich habe mich mal entschieden, das Ding einfach mal hoch zu laden. Es ist noch eine unfertige Version. Ich habe einfach keine Lust die Druckfunktion und die Importfunktion einzubauen. Mal sehen, wann ich mich dazu überwinden kann. Sprich Importieren und Drucken geht noch nicht.
Beruhen tut das ganze auf typisierten Dateien und meiner Unit TypedFiles.pas, welche auch auf meiner HP zu finden ist. Alles andere ist reiner Win32API Krimskrams. Das Herz bildet wie gesagt die TypedFiles Unit.
Natürlich wie immer OpenSource, obwohl ich bezweifle, dass da noch jemand,...
|
|